All Aboard: Trump Takes Off For Second Debate

Republican presidential nominee Donald Trump is on his way to St. Louis for the second debate against rival Hillary Clinton after a weekend of damage control, an apology and mass exodus of Republican leadership support.

Trump campaign manager Kellyanne Conway, who took a hiatus from social media and news interviews late Friday and through Sunday morning, sent out the following photo on her Twitter feed this afternoon. 

RNC Chairman Reince Priebus, who expressed disappointment in Trump's comments about "grabbing women by the p*ssy," is traveling with the nominee. Former New York City Mayor Rudy Guiliani, who made the rounds on the Sunday shows today in place of Conway, is also on the plane. Vice presidential candidate Mike Pence, who took a public break from the campaign yesterday, will resume his position and travel schedule Monday.
